After winning the gold medal in the men’s halfpipe with a dramatic final round score of 97.75, Shaun White did what most Olympic athletes do, he hugged people, he celebrated, he cried and was then handed an American flag. Unfortunately for White and several online tweeters, the flag ended up being the only part of his performance that went negatively.
As White passed the flag to his right hand, the hand that was clutching his snowboard, the flag ended up on the ground being drug through the snow while he walked off the hill.
